Obituary of Warren Jeffrey "Jeff" Card

Willingboro: Warren Jeffrey “Jeff” Card, age 75 of Willingboro, New Jersey departed this life on Friday, February 2, 2024. Mr. Card was born in Kodiak, Alaska and was the son of the late Fred S. Card and Elsie Rasanen Card.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his brother, Fred. Jeff called Willingboro his home for the majority of his life. He was a retired Union Carpenter with 22 years of service and a Boiler Maker for 18 years. Warren served his Country with honor in the United States Army during the Vietnam War. Mr. Card was a member of the Carpenter's Local 1489, the Mozart Lodge #121 of the Free and Accepted Masons in Merchantville, NJ and the Springfield Golf Club. He enjoyed both surf and fresh water fishing and flying his plane to new heights after obtaining his pilot’s license. Undoubtedly, golfing at Springfield and spending quality time with his family remained his most favorite activities. He is survived by the love of his life for 48 years, Denise Weinmann Card, his sisters and a brother-in-law, Linda Card and Valerie Card Breunig and Kevin Breunig, his sister- in-law and brother-in-law, Carla and Michael McGurk and their family, Tan and Emily, Billie and Ruby and Colin, nieces and nephews as well as many friends and acquaintances. Funeral services and final disposition will be held privately. There will be no visitation. Condolences may be sent to www.koschekandporterfuneralhome.com
